About Lego® Friends: Girlz 4 Life

The new movie, Lego® Friends: Girlz 4 Life, is all about friendship, trusting yourself and standing up for what’s right no matter what the cost. All set to an awesome rock soundtrack you’re going to love! Join Olivia, Stephanie, Emma, Mia and Andrea as they learn that fame isn’t important, it’s your friends that count! Lego® Friends: Girlz 4 Life brings to life (in animated form) the Lego construction based toy Lego® Friends. Lego® Friends invites girls into a universe, Heartlake city, and inspires them to use their imagination to build and role play their own stories with fun-loving relatable characters.

True Friendship in the Glamorous World of Pop!

Join Olivia, Stephanie, Emma, Mia and Andrea, as they learn about friendship, fame and pop star fun in Heartlake City.

The girls’ friendships are tested when mega pop star Livi comes to Heartlake City. When our friends’ hit song “Girlz” is stolen by Livi’s manager, it’s time for a cunning plan.

As the girls try to tell Livi the truth about her latest hit single, they all learn that fame isn’t everything and sometimes friendship is the most precious thing in the world.
